Mechanical Anemometers
Mechanical anemometers, often viewed as the classic choice, utilize a series of rotating cups or blades to gauge wind speed. One notable aspect of these devices is their simplicity. They don’t require batteries or complex electronics, which makes them reliable, especially in remote situations where power might not be available. For sailors, this robustness is key.
A key characteristic of mechanical anemometers is their durability; they can withstand harsh marine environments. However, they might be less precise than some digital counterparts. While it takes a bit of effort to read them accurately, the tactile feedback can be an advantage for those who prefer hands-on tools.
An example of this type is the Dwyer Series 40, which offers an easy-to-read dial and is notably user-friendly, making it popular among those starting in sailing or outdoor activities. The unique feature is the non-electric operation; no risk of battery failure means consistent performance, even in the wild.
Digital Anemometers
Shifting gears, we have digital anemometers, which have surged in popularity due to their accuracy and advanced features. These gadgets use electronic sensors and provide real-time, precise wind speed data. This level of detail is invaluable for experienced sailors or those racing where every knot counts.
A significant characteristic of digital anemometers is the display. They often feature backlit screens, making them easy to read in varying light conditions, including sunny days on the water. The versatility of these devices is further enhanced by their ability to record and store data, a typical feature you would notice in models such as the Kestrel 3500.
One of the standout aspects of digital anemometers is their memory function, allowing sailors to track wind patterns over time. However, it’s worth noting that they depend on batteries, which might be a consideration for extended journeys.

Measurement Range and Accuracy
The measurement range is one of the cornerstone elements to consider when selecting a wind meter. Different models can record various wind speeds, generally ranging from light breezes of a few knots up to powerful gusts that exceed fifty knots. For example, if you plan to sail in coastal areas where conditions can change rapidly, a wind meter capable of measuring a wide range of wind speeds will better serve your needs.
Accuracy is equally important. A device that provides precise readings ensures that you are acting on reliable data rather than guesswork. Look for models with a stated accuracy of within 0.5 to 1.0 knots under standard conditions. Consistency in readings from device to device can vary, and while one meter may seem appealing, that might not be the one to trust on a turbulent day on the water.

Proper Handling Techniques
Using a handheld wind meter isn’t just as simple as pointing it at the wind and pressing a button. Proper handling is crucial for achieving accurate readings.
- Grip it Firmly: Hold the wind meter with both hands, ensuring a stable base. The slightest shake or movement can throw off the accuracy.
- Point into the Wind: Always face the wind directly. If you're not aligned with the wind's direction, your readings will be skewed.
- Avoid Obstacles: Make sure you’re at a location where surrounding structures or sails aren't interfering with wind flow. Being in the open ensures reliability.
- Stay Still: When taking measurements, avoid movement. If you're bouncing around on deck, your readings will reflect that instability.
- Use a Lanyard: To prevent accidental drops, consider using a lanyard. This simple precaution allows you to focus on readings without the fear of dropping the device overboard.
Interpreting Measurements
Now that you've handled the wind meter properly, interpreting the figures it displays is the next step.
Check these aspects carefully:
- Wind Speed: This is measured in knots or miles per hour. Know the critical thresholds that matter for your sailing style. For instance, racing sailors often need to adjust their rigging significantly once winds exceed a specific speed.
- Wind Direction: Many models will indicate where the wind is coming from. Understanding prevailing winds is essential, especially when planning your routes.
- Gusts vs. Steady Wind: Pay attention to gusts which may be brief. It’s important to distinguish between average wind speed and sudden gusts that could affect your vessel's performance.
- Data Logging: Some advanced meters log data for historical analysis. Use these to your advantage in future trips to assess patterns.
Following these guidelines will ensure that you're not just crunching numbers but making informed decisions based on reliable data.
Integrating Data into Sailing Decisions
Once you have accurate readings, it's time to weave those insights into your sailing strategy. Here are a few ways to go about it:
- Adjusting Sail Configuration: If your readings show consistently high winds, it might be wise to reef your sails. On the flip side, underpowered readings might encourage you to unfurl more sail area to capture additional breeze.
- Navigational Strategy: Understanding wind patterns can inform your route choices. If you’re aware of shifting winds, you can adjust your heading preemptively instead of reacting.
- Safety Precautions: High wind measurements can signal the need for immediate action. Be prepared to navigate away from hazardous areas or drop sails if needed.
- Anticipating Conditions: Knowing that the wind often picks up in the evening or after passing storms can help you prepare in advance.

Cleaning and Care
Cleaning a wind meter may sound straightforward, yet it’s often overlooked. Saltwater, dirt, and other environmental factors can accumulate on these devices, affecting their sensors and overall accuracy. To maintain optimal performance, one should follow these best practices:
- Routine Wiping: Use a soft, damp cloth to routinely wipe down the device after each trip to prevent salt crust from forming. Avoid abrasive materials that might scratch the surface.
- Drying: After exposure to water, either from sailing or rain, ensure the device dries completely to prevent corrosion. A gentle shake can help remove excess water.
- Protective Cases: Consider using a protective case that can guard against impacts and weather extremes when the device is not in use. This added layer can be a lifesaver in rough conditions.
Keeping the entire unit, especially the display and sensors, clean will ensure you get precise readings critical for decision-making on the water.
Software Updates and Calibration
When it comes to tech-heavy equipment, ignoring software updates can lead to a host of issues, from missing features to inaccurate data. It’s important to regularly check for any necessary updates from the manufacturer. These updates can include improvements and fixes that enhance the accuracy and usability of the wind meter.
Calibration, on the other hand, is equally vital. It’s the process that aligns the sensor’s output with the actual wind conditions. Here’s what to consider:
- Frequency of Calibration: Depending on how often the wind meter is used, calibration should occur periodically. If used in varying conditions or after a drop, recalibration is warranted.
- Manufacturer Guidelines: Always consult the owner’s manual for specific calibration instructions tailored to your model.
- Professional Help: If unsure, seeking professional calibration services or reaching out to the vendor can help maintain the integrity of your readings.
